Fraud Detection Market Set for Explosive Growth as AI and Cloud Monitoring Take Center Stage

The global fraud detection and prevention market is expected to grow at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 18% from 2026 to 2033, reaching $122.86 billion by 2033, up from $34.05 billion in 2025. North America currently holds the largest share of the market due to strong cybersecurity investments and widespread digital payment adoption.

Artificial intelligence (AI), machine learning, behavioral analytics, and cloud-based monitoring are key technologies driving growth in the market. These tools enable organizations to improve fraud detection while reducing false alerts.

The BFSI sector leads the market, accounting for around 34% of the total share, due to its high volume of financial transactions and need for secure payment systems. Top players in the market include IBM, FICO, SAS, BAE Systems, and Fiserv.
